Outbound spam control in Office 365 is at the organization level, similar to connection filters. As a result, there is only one default outbound spam preference entry; this filter applies to all mailboxes. This filter has the following two settings:
Send a copy of all suspicious outbound email messages to the following email address or addresses. This option enables you to specify the email address or addresses of administrators who will receive copies of all suspicious outbound messages. If sending to multiple addresses, separate the addresses with a semicolon
Send a notification to the following email address or addresses when a sender is blocked for sending outbound spam. This option enables you to specify the administrator email address or addresses to notify when outbound messages identified as spam are blocked. Again, use a semicolon to separate multiple addresses.
